Frequently asked questions
- Is Houston, TX cheaper or more expensive than Portland, OR?
- Houston, TX (RPP 98.8) is cheaper than Portland, OR (RPP 108.8) by about 9.2%.
- What salary do I need in Houston, TX if I earn $100,000 in Portland, OR?
- You would need approximately $90,809 in Houston, TX to maintain the same purchasing power as $100,000 in Portland, OR. Formula: $100,000 x (98.8 / 108.8).
